Nigeria, a country known for its vibrant and resilient people with resources abundant in the nation has been hijacked by our government for their selfish gains. For a while now the country has been observing what I call a Nationwide protest aimed at stopping bad government and eradicating corruption and poverty in the country. The protest led by millions of Nigerian youth is a call for a change, a demand for a good government and, an end to the continuous corruption in the country.

IMG_20240804_222903.jpg



The protest which started as a social media tweet has now been taken into action by thousands of Nigerian youth as they march into the streets, to express their frustration with the government. The protest which started on first August of this month has began to make an impact in the country as leader and governor call for a calm and retrain. However the protesters don't want just words, they want action. As the protest continues it is better for the government to hear the cries and agony of the people and take concrete steps in addressing their concerns.

IMG_20240804_222555.jpg



The recent protest in Nigeria is not just a reaction to the current government but also a cumulation of neglect and the high cost of living in the country. Nigerian are hungry, frustrated and don't know what to do as the price of things in the market keeps on increasing day by day, this protest was planned to make the government see the hardship they make Nigerian pass through everyday. It is sad to see how Nigerian are suffering every day by day to just make a living and at the end of the day there is nothing to go home with. This protest is a wake up call for the government and the people in higher office to take accountability, make a good government and transparency in the country, the government must take action and take steps to address the concern of Nigerian before it escalates to a more serious issue.


The future of the country hangs in the balance, it is up to the government and the people to make this country a better place. The recent protest is a call to action a reminder that change is never impossible and that the people will no longer accept corruption in the country. The government must listen to the peoples demand and take action necessary because the future of the country depends on it.
